The Art of Making Your Own Push Popsicle

Creating your own push popsicle is an exciting venture into the world of homemade desserts. At its core, it involves freezing juice, yogurt, or creamy mixtures in cylindrical molds that include a push-up stick. As you explore this creative activity, you have the chance to mix and match different ingredients, invent unique flavor combinations, and even add layers of fruits, nuts, or herbs.

The process begins with choosing a base. Options such as fruit puree, juice, yogurt, or a blend of cream and milk provide varied textures and tastes. Next, sweeteners like honey or maple syrup can be adjusted to one’s preference. Finally, incorporating add-ins like chia seeds, fresh fruit slices, or chocolate chips can transform a simple treat into a gourmet experience.

Benefits of Homemade Push Popsicles

Making your own push popsicle treats at home allows for more control over ingredients, ensuring a healthier indulgence. By selecting natural sweeteners and fresh fruits, you can tailor your popsicles to fit specific dietary needs or health preferences. This customization reduces the added sugars and artificial flavors often found in store-bought varieties.

Additionally, preparing push popsicles is a fantastic family activity. It encourages children to engage with food in a hands-on way, promoting creativity and teaching valuable kitchen skills. This shared activity can enhance family bonds while educating the younger generation about healthy eating practices.

Nutritional Value and Considerations

Push popsicles made at home with whole, nutritious ingredients can be a viable addition to a balanced diet. By opting for fruits high in vitamins and antioxidants, such as berries or citrus, push popsicles can contribute to daily nutritional intake. Yogurt-based popsicles also provide probiotics and calcium.

It is important, however, to be mindful of portion sizes and ingredient choices. While customizing a push popsicle, consider opting for low-fat or non-dairy alternatives to accommodate varied dietary requirements or personal health goals. Can push popsicles be made without dairy?

Yes, push popsicles can easily be made without dairy. Alternatives like coconut milk, almond milk, or soy yogurt serve as excellent substitutes.

Are there any tips for making layered push popsicles?

To create layered push popsicles, pour one layer at a time and freeze each completely before adding the next. This prevents colors and flavors from mixing.

What are some flavor combinations for push popsicles?

Popular flavor combinations include strawberry-banana, lemon-lime, and mango-coconut. Mixing sweet and tangy flavors provides a delightful contrast.
